I have made 800k floppy disk images (with read/write option) of the word 5.1 install disks using Apple disk copy v6.3.3. I mounted the disks and launched the setup program but I got this error message. Any ideas what is going on? I checked and nothing seems locked. Every thing works and installs fine in Sheepshaver with OS9, but not Basilisk II.

I am using Basilisk II for windows NT v0.8 build 142.

Thank you both for your responses.
I did some more research and found that the Word 5.1 installer is buggy. I ended up clicking the customize button, which allows you to continue the installation form there. There were a few options from the customized menu that I did not select (such as system resources and the Equation Editor).

Here is the complete list I ended up with.

----------------------------------------------------------------
For install in Mac OS 7.5.5 (also o.k. for OS 9.0.4) :
-Do a custom install.
-select everything except these options:
Complete Install (No Sys. Resources)
Minimal Install
PowerBook Install
Equation Editor Only
Equation Editor with System Resources
Voice Annotation Only
Voice Annotation: Macintosh Portable
Voice Annotation: System 6.0.5 and Before
Voice Annotation: System 6.0.6 and Later
System Resources for Macintosh Portable
System Resources for 6.0.5 and Before
System Resources for 6.0.6 and Later
